Breaking Down the Features of Streamlight Strion LED HL w/240V AC/12V DC, 2 – 1 out of 3 models

Specifications

  • C4 LED Technology: The Streamlight Strion LED HL utilizes Streamlight’s C4 LED technology, which is virtually indestructible and boasts a 50,000-hour lifespan. This means decades of use without worrying about bulb replacements.
  • Lithium-Ion Battery: The light is powered by a lithium-ion battery that is rechargeable up to 1000 times. This eliminates the need for frequent battery replacements and offers significant cost savings.
  • Charging System: The clamp-style charger features a digital control circuit to prevent overcharging. An LED indicator displays the charging status, ensuring safe and efficient charging.
  • Durability: The Strion HL is IPX4 water-resistant and 2-meter impact resistance tested. This makes it suitable for use in harsh environments and ensures it can withstand accidental drops and splashes.
  • Construction: The light is constructed from 6000 series machined aircraft aluminum with an anodized finish. This provides excellent durability and corrosion resistance while keeping the weight manageable.
  • Lens: The Strion HL features a Borofloat high-temperature glass lens. This resists damage from heat and impact.
  • Anti-Roll Head: The anti-roll head prevents the light from rolling away when placed on uneven surfaces. This seems minor, but it’s invaluable on uneven terrain.
  • Grooved Barrel: The grooved barrel allows easy adaptation to long gun mounts. This adds versatility for tactical or hunting applications.
  • Serialized: Each light is serialized for positive identification. This makes it easier to track and manage the light.
